Planting Calendar for Marigold

Frost tolerance for marigold: Not tolerant of frost.
When to plant: After the last frost when the weather gets warmer.

You should not plant marigold until after the last frost when the weather gets warmer because they require warm weather.

The earliest that you can plant marigold in Matthews is April. However, you really should wait until May if you don't want to take any chances.

The last month that you can plant marigold and expect a good harvest is probably August. You probably don't want to wait any later than that or else your marigold may not have a chance to really do well. Starting your marigold indoors is a great way to get them started a little bit earlier.

Last Frost Date

On average the last frost when the weather gets warmer is on April 15 in Matthews. In the coldest months of winter you should expect an average low temperature of 5°F.

Just be sure to remember that the actual date of last frost may not be accurate from year to year because it is based on the USDA zone info for Matthews and it is different every year. Half of the time in Matthews you get a frost after April 15 so make sure that you are ready to protect your marigold in the event of a surprise late frost.
